Transaction 4defe101738f0b8a214329df9807b0eb076f8e2407ed8fbff30f9a7c0821286b

28 Input
2 Outputs
  • 4defe101738f0b8a214329df9807b0eb076f8e2407ed8fbff30f9a7c0821286b:0
  • value  577990
    address  1HeX8b9kyj7ueENRtV9o2heX12iPmuHWn2
  • 4defe101738f0b8a214329df9807b0eb076f8e2407ed8fbff30f9a7c0821286b:1
  • value  183895504
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s